White Chocolate Raspberry Rolls (Print Version)

Brioche filled with white chocolate and raspberries, topped with creamy vanilla glaze and fruity raspberry pieces.

# What You’ll Need:

→ Brioche Dough

01 - 500 g all-purpose flour
02 - 60 g granulated sugar
03 - 7 g instant dry yeast
04 - 1 tsp fine sea salt
05 - 180 ml whole milk, lukewarm
06 - 3 large eggs, room temperature
07 - 120 g unsalted butter, softened and cubed

→ Filling

08 - 100 g white chocolate, finely chopped
09 - 120 g raspberry jam
10 - 50 g fresh or frozen raspberries (optional)

→ Glaze

11 - 100 g white chocolate, chopped
12 - 60 ml heavy cream
13 - 1/2 tsp pure vanilla extract
14 - 30 g powdered sugar

→ Decoration

15 - 2 tbsp freeze-dried raspberries, lightly crushed

# How to Make It:

01 - In a large bowl or stand mixer, mix together flour, sugar, yeast, and salt.
02 - Add lukewarm milk and eggs to the dry ingredients. Mix until a ragged dough is formed.
03 - Gradually incorporate softened butter, a few pieces at a time, kneading until fully absorbed and the dough becomes smooth and elastic, about 10 minutes.
04 - Cover the bowl and let the dough rise in a warm location until doubled in volume, 1 to 1.5 hours.
05 - Deflate the risen dough and stretch it on a lightly floured surface into a rectangle approximately 40 x 30 cm.
06 - Evenly spread raspberry jam over the dough, leaving a 1 cm border. Sprinkle chopped white chocolate and add raspberries if using.
07 - Tightly roll the dough into a log from the long side. Cut into 12 equal pieces.
08 - Arrange rolls, cut side up, in a parchment-lined 23 x 33 cm baking pan. Cover and let rise until puffy, 45–60 minutes.
09 - Preheat oven to 180°C. Bake the rolls for 22–25 minutes until golden brown and baked through. Allow to cool slightly.
10 - Gently heat cream in a saucepan until steaming; remove from heat. Stir in chopped white chocolate until melted, then whisk in vanilla extract and powdered sugar until smooth.
11 - Drizzle glaze over warm rolls. Sprinkle with crushed freeze-dried raspberries. Serve warm or at room temperature.

03 -
  • Always check that your yeast is fresh or the dough will not rise properly
  • Roll the dough tightly so your swirls stay neat and filling does not spill out
  • Do not overbake or the rolls will lose their signature softness
